Relationship Between Duration of Diabetes, HbA1c Levels and Olfactory Dysfunction in Patients with Type 2 Diabetes: A Pilot Study

Abstract

Introduction: We aimed to investigate whether duration of diabetes and HbA1c levels in patients with Type 2 diabetes mellitus (DM) are associated with olfactory dysfunction.

Material and Methods: Fifty patients with prior Type 2 DM diagnoses under antidiabetic treatment were included to the study. We used the Turkish version of The Brief Smell Identification Test (B-SIT) including 12 different odorants to test the odor functions of patients. Age, weight, height, HbA1C levels, duration of diabetes and test results of the patients participating in the study were recorded and necessary analysis was performed. p value <0.05 was considered statistically significant.

Results: There was no significant correlation between duration of diabetes and HbA1c levels and B-SIT scores.

Conclusion: In order to confirm our findings further studies with larger sample sizes, with patients with longer duration of DM are needed.
